摘要
Laboratory measurements in low turbulence-intensity wind tunnel were made of flow and mass transfer over a blunt flat plate of finite thickness, which is placed in a pulsating free stream, U = U-o(1 + A(o)cos2 pi f(p)t). The majority of experiments were carried out in the ranges of 1000 less than or equal to Re-H less than or equal to 7000 and 20.0 less than or equal to f(p) less than or equal to 80.0 Hz and A(o) less than or equal to 0.13. Flow properties were measured by I-type and split-film probes. Mass transfer rates were measured by employing the naphthalene sublimation technique. The present results for non-pulsation flows (A(o) = 0.0) were shown to be consistent with the published data. For pulsating approach flows, as A(o) or f(p) increases, the time-mean reattachment length is reduced significantly; the position where C-p is recovered moves upstream, and the minimum value of C-p decreases; the secondary separation point and the position where Sh has a maximum move further upstream. Especially in the zone of separation bubble, the effect of pulsation on Sh is conspicuous. At large Re-H, the relative influence of pulsation on Sh weakens.
